Abstract

The exponentially correlated Hylleraas-configuration interaction wave function (E-Hy-CI) is a generalization of the Hylleraas-configuration interaction (Hy-CI) in which the single r(ij) of an Hy-CI wave function is generalized to the generic type r(ij)(nu ij)e(-omega ijrij). This type of correlation has the right behavior both in the vicinity of the r(ij) cusp and as r(ij) goes to infinity; this work shows that wave functions containing both linear and exponential r(ij) factors converge more rapidly than either one alone for low-lying excited states of S-1 symmetry. E-Hy-CI variational calculations with up to 8568 configurations lead to a nonrelativistic energy of -7.2799 1341 2669 3059 6491 6759 hartree for the 1 S-1 ground state of the Li+ ion.
